The Neuer Gehren retirement center in Erlenbach offers modern living space for older people. The new building was planned by Graber Pulver Architekten AG of Zurich and completed in 2017. Steiner AG was responsible as the general contractor. The center comprises around 5,500 m² of floor space and offers 61 care studios and 18 apartments for the elderly. It serves as a central point of contact for retirement issues in the community. The facade consists of prefabricated, carbon-fiber-reinforced fine concrete elements.
Why carbon concrete?
The balconies and balustrades are a special feature of the building. They have large concrete balustrades that shape the appearance. These elements should be light, stable and corrosion-resistant. Steel would have been unsuitable here because it rusts and requires thicker concrete cover layers. The solution: carbon reinforcement from solidian. The reinforcement grids were individually manufactured and cut to size for the special shape and design. Sulser AG produced the prefabricated parts and achieved excellent results with the highest quality.
Carbon replaces steel as reinforcement and makes the concrete particularly durable and long-lasting. It enables slender but strong components. This meant that the balustrades could be made thinner and lighter – without losing any stability.
Technical data
- Material: concrete with carbon reinforcement solidian GRID
- Size: up to 2.3 m x 3.4 m
- Thickness: 4–6 cm
- Quantity: 170 pieces
- Weight: up to 50% lighter than reinforced concrete
- Corrosion protection: no additional protection necessary
- Production: prefabricated elements by Sulser AG
- Installation: installed with a crane
Advantages of carbon concrete
🟠 Non-corrosive – No steel, no damage.
🟠 Lighter than steel reinforced concrete – Less weight saves on transport and assembly costs.
🟠 Less material used – Thinner components, less concrete used.
🟠 More design options – Fine, filigree shapes are possible.
🟠 Sustainable – Less concrete means lower CO₂ emissions.
